Metal Oxide Resistor

As the core part of surge arrester, metal oxide resistor is made according to the following procedure: add a little bismuth oxide, cobalt oxide, chromium oxide, manganese carbonate, stibium  oxide and other microcrystalline additives to the main component-zinc oxide and then burn in high temperature at 1200℃. Metal oxide resistor mainly consists of zinc oxide grain, crystal boundary layer and spinel. It's generally considered that zinc grain has better conductivity; the voltage upon zinc oxide grain nearly totally affect on high resistant crystal layer(taking bismuth oxide as main component).Spinel ,as the component oxide made up of zinc oxide and stibium oxide distributions in the crystal boundary layer to limit the growing of zinc oxide grain and make resistor of better nonlinear characteristics. CHINT metal oxide resistor features flat v-t characteristics curves within large current range and superior nonlinear. It also features for excellent over voltage protection level due to its low residual voltage and large current passing capacity and is widely used in all kinds of surge arresters to absorb the energy in over voltage system.

MV Water-proof and Water Tree Retardant Power Cable

1 Standard The products should be manufactured according to standard GB/T12706-2008 and also as per IEC, BS and HD as requested. 2 Application The products should be suitable for buried cables under the moist, abundant groundwater or water tree growth inhibiting and safely operating transmission and distribution lines of rated voltages of 3.6/6~26/35kV 3 Properties TR cables should be insulated by electrical and water tree growth inhibiting TR insulated compound. After 729-day water tree ageing accumulation test according to the requirements for tree retardant performance in HD605. The products prolong the cables' lives and improve safety, and they are the upgrade of XLPE insulated cables. Longitudinal water-proof cables combine water-proof material, inhibiting the growth of water tree in the conductor, satisfying the conductivity of the cable; Radical water-proof cables combine Al-plastic tape and polyolefin sheath and have longitudinal and radical water-blocking properties.
